The salary figures below come from 94 active job postings for teachers currently listed on this board. Fifty-two postings offer hourly pay, reflecting permanent or staff positions, with a median of $22.15/hr, a lower quartile of $18.47/hr, and an upper quartile of $27.72/hr. Forty-two postings list annual salaries, typically for contract or travel roles, with a median of $55,083/yr, a lower quartile of $47,307/yr, and an upper quartile of $62,397/yr. Among states with substantial postings, California shows the highest median hourly rate at $26.48/hr across 25 positions.

How we calculate this. Figures come from pay ranges published in job postings currently live on Vast Job Finder, not from a salary survey or self-reported data. We use each posting’s starting pay and publish a figure only when at least 25 postings support it. Employers quote pay differently, so weekly and annual figures are converted to an hourly equivalent at 40 hours a week and 52 weeks a year to make them comparable. Travel and contract assignments are shown separately from staff roles because the work and the pay structure differ. Recomputed monthly as inventory turns over.
